Strava Live Segments is worse with the latest software update. Why Garmin, WHY?

I had started a thread on my frustrations with Strava Live Segments, mostly with keeping a target (PR, KOM etc).

The new features of "last" or "recent best" are useless. All anybody wants is to set a target, and have it not change. My 530 changes the targets randomly.

A way around this was to set a "goal" on Strava, which would then show as the target. But since the latest software update, my 530 defaulted to picking random targets, no longer defaults to my goal, and changes with every ride. My "Goal" appears on the screen for a few seconds, then disappears and is replaced with a target that I could not care less about and don't want to use.

Why can't Garmin just fix this?

My FR935 has never had this problem, but looking at my watch while sprinting is not feasible.

Why did the latest software update make this worse than it already was?

This is incredibly frustrating.

PLEASE fix this Garmin.

    I had an interesting thing happen yesterday while using Live Segments.

    I did the Mt. Washington bike race, and loaded the 7.5 mile segment with a goal.

    It started fine, but below the arrow, three target numbers were all displayed, but on top of each other in a jumbled mess.

    I think that my goal, KOM & person I follow in front of me were the three numbers, but because they were all taking up the same space it was difficult to see what was what.

    I was using six data boxes.

    Thankfully I set a separate page with all of the numbers that I needed (time ahead, behind, distance to go etc.) so that it wasn't an issue, but if I had to rely on the segment screen, it would have been a disaster.
